Double Charlotte's Special Burger at Lovely's Old Fashioned

I was walking around Bryant Park in the early afternoon. My upcoming lunch plans got moved around leaving me free to find something else. I was in the mood for a burger so I looked at places I had saved. Lovely's was a bit of a walk but nothing too crazy.

As I rounded the corner onto 9th Avenue, I could already smell the burgers in the air. I saw the big green awning and I knew I found the right place. There's a register right in the front and a counter that runs the length of the shop. Almost every seat was taken and a few people were in line to order burgers. I ordered at the register and then took a seat towards the end of the counter.

The whole place represents the "Old Fashioned" part of the name well. The team there has the old-school white hats. The Americana is represented in the signs above the open kitchen area. The fries and onion rings prepared for takeout orders even get served in the classic blue NYC coffee cups.

I ordered the Charlotte's Special Burger. It's a single by default but I made it a double. I asked the person at the register for his recommendation between fries and onion rings. He suggested the onion rings so that's what I got. I rounded it out with a Coke Zero.

The Charlotte's Special has griddled onions, American cheese, and a burger sauce. It's a smashed patty but not smashed so thin as a smashburger might. This is smashed to get contact on the griddle and develop a crust. Smashing it to the bun's diameter keeps the center juicy. The burger was steaming hot. It reminds me of Motz Onion Burger.

There's a lot of onions in the burger. I like onions. The caramelized onion sweetness was a strong component of this burger. There were so many onions that I found the burger slipping around between the bun. The cheese brought the salt and fat to the burger, more cheese might have kept it in place between the buns. The potato bun did the job. The burger stayed together. That old-school burger counter vibe carried through even to the last bite.

Onion Rings at Lovely's Old Fashioned

The person at the register made a good recommendation. It's a generous portion size. The onion rings came fresh from the fryer and well salted. The onions were fully cooked but kept their texture. You could bite through the onion ring without pulling it out of the batter. It's a rare balance to find and they nailed it.
